ALV1 is a molecular glue degrader for Ikaros (IKZF1) and Helios (IKZF2) with DC50 of 2.5 nM and 10.3 nM respectively. ALV1 bind CRBN with an IC50 of 0.55 μM, and induces CRBN-Helios dimerization. ALV1 can be used to study the properties and functions of regulatory T cells.

ALV1 (0-10 μM, 4-18 h) induces Ikaros and Helios degradation and promotes IL-2 secretion in Jurkat cells[1].
ALV1 (1 μM, 24 h) effectively induces Ikaros and Helios degradation in Treg cells isolated from human peripheral blood[1].
ALV1 (0.1-10 μM, 4 h) induces degradation of both Ikaros and Helios but does not affect the stability of GSPT1 in Jurkat cells[1].
ALV1 (1 μM, 4 h) induces Helios degradation without unexpected off-target activity in Jurkat cells [1].
ALV1 (1 μM, 18 h) promotes IL-2 secretion to a greater extent than Lenalidomide (HY-A0003) in Jurkat cells, suggesting Helios more strongly represses IL-2 production in this context[1].

Add each solvent one by one: 10% DMSO 40% PEG300 5% Tween-80 45% Saline
Solubility: 2.5 mg/mL (5.05 mM); Suspended solution; Need ultrasonic
This protocol yields a suspended solution of 2.5 mg/mL. Suspended solution can be used for oral and intraperitoneal injection.
Taking 1 mL working solution as an example, add 100 μL DMSO stock solution (25.0 mg/mL) to 400 μL PEG300, and mix evenly; then add 50 μL Tween-80 and mix evenly; then add 450 μL Saline to adjust the volume to 1 mL.
Preparation of Saline: Dissolve 0.9 g sodium chloride in ddH₂O and dilute to 100 mL to obtain a clear Saline solution.
